This role is responsible for developing the tools necessary for Personal Lines rate revisions, including auto, home, and umbrella insurance. The candidate must understand Personal Lines products and rating structures, historical rate changes, and state-specific information. Additionally, the role requires excellent technical skills and a keen attention to detail.
Responsibilities
- Responsible for building and managing Personal Lines auto, home, and umbrella off-balance builds.
- Learn and understand Personal Lines insurance, company products, rate revision processes, and tools in great detail.
- Produce tools incorporating indications, in-force, and retention trends to adjust base rates and achieve specific rate levels for each state and product.
- Develop tools to calculate each policy's premium using current rates and incorporating proposed adjustments to base rates and other factors.
- Determine the quality of data and flag defects and discrepancies for Data Solutions.
- Troubleshoot and fix errors in the tools.
- Document changes and adjustments to tools and processes.
- Monitor and manage deadlines and deliverables.
- Communicate with State Management, Analytics, Data, Project, and Implementation teams to ensure a comprehensive understanding of rate change strategies, correct tool usage, and timely delivery.
